The ATMEGA329P-20MU is a high-performance, low-power 8-bit microcontroller by Microchip Technology. It belongs to the popular ATmega series of microcontrollers and offers various features suitable for a wide range of applications.
Key features of the ATMEGA329P-20MU include:
1. Architecture: It is based on an advanced RISC architecture, providing high processing power with reduced instruction execution time.
2. CPU Speed: It operates at a clock frequency of up to 20 MHz, allowing for quick execution of instructions and efficient processing.
3. Memory: The microcontroller has a total of 32 kilobytes (KB) of flash program memory for storing the application code. Additionally, it offers 2 KB of SRAM for data storage.
4. I/O Ports: It provides a significant number of I/O pins, including 32 General Purpose I/O (GPIO) pins, which can be configured for various purposes based on the application requirements.
5. Serial Communication: The ATMEGA329P-20MU supports multiple communication interfaces, such as UART, SPI, and I2C. These interfaces enable seamless communication with other devices, sensors, or peripherals.
6. Analog-to-Digital Converter (ADC): It includes a 10-bit ADC with eight channels, allowing for precise measurement of analog signals. This feature is particularly useful in applications that require the conversion of real-world physical signals to digital values